Summary
This review paper pulls together existing research on how tiny plastic particles (microplastics) are polluting our oceans, where they come from, and how they spread through marine ecosystems. It matters for your health because these plastics work their way up the food chain — from tiny sea creatures to the fish and shellfish on your plate — and scientists are still trying to understand the full impact of ingesting them over time.
